The Educational Revolution

Games have long been recognized as a valuable tool for learning. Educational games like Minecraft: Education Edition and Civilization VI have been designed to teach complex concepts like science, history, and critical thinking. These games not only engage students but also provide a safe and interactive environment for them to explore and learn.

One notable example is the use of games in teaching empathy and understanding. Games like This War of Mine and Papers, Please challenge players to make difficult moral choices, raising awareness about the human cost of conflict and the importance of compassion. These games humanize complex issues, making them more relatable and accessible to a wider audience.

Real-World Applications and Success Stories

The impact of games on society is not limited to entertainment. Games have been used in various contexts, including:

* Therapy and rehabilitation: Games like Beat Saber and Just Dance have been used to aid in physical therapy and rehabilitation, helping patients recover from injuries and improve their motor skills.

* Environmental conservation: Games like Eco and Feeder have raised awareness about environmental issues like pollution and climate change, encouraging players to take action and make sustainable choices.

* Mental health: Games like Night in the Woods and Hellblade: Senua’s Sacrifice have addressed mental health issues like anxiety, depression, and trauma, providing a safe space for players to explore and process their emotions.
